A former town in Kitaakita County, northern Akita Prefecture. Most of the area is mountainous, with Mt. Moriyoshi as its main peak. The Ani River runs through the west, and the Komata River, a tributary of the Ani River, runs through the east. The Akita Inland Longitudinal Railway passes through the area. Dairy farming, including beef and dairy cattle, is thriving. Tobacco leaves and potatoes are also produced. Mt. Moriyoshi is located in the southeast. In March 2005, it merged with Takanosu Town, Ani Town, and Aikawa Town in Kitaakita County to become a city, Kitaakita City. 341.88 km2 . 7,797 people (2003).
